L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Clean aluminum tray with a soft cloth and mild detergent; rinse with warm water and dry immediately to prevent spotting. Use non-abrasive pads to remove baked-on residue. Sanitize high-touch areas like rims and serving edges with approved sanitizer; allow contact time per label. Inspect for pitting or bends; store trays flat in a dry area. Clean with warm water and mild detergent using a nonabrasive pad; rinse thoroughly to remove residue. Dry immediately to prevent oxidation and store flat to avoid deformation. Rotate inventory to prevent long-term surface wear. Follow CSA and local sanitation codes for temperature and handling, and document maintenance weekly.
